
Reptilia · Squamata
Petrosaurus thalassinusCope, 1863
Baja California Rock Lizard
Photograph by MarvalPhotography19, CC BY, via iNaturalist
A rock-dwelling, day-active, omnivorous lizard from the Nearctic region, reaching 175 mm snout to vent.
Once published as Uta repens, Uta thalassina — those names reach this page.

(Grismer 2002, Cardona-Botero et al. 2020), about 50% arthropods and 50% plants, also subadults of own species (Aguirre and Gatica 2010), plants and usually insects (Stebbins and McGinnis 2018), invertebrates, leaves, flowers and seeds, and cannibalistic (Heimes 2022)
Diurnal, diurnal and heliothermic (Heimes 2022)
(e.g., Olberding et al. 2016, Cardona-Botero et al. 2020, Heimes 2022), primarily saxicolous, occasionally forages on the ground (Stebbins and McGinnis 2018)
max 2020 (Heimes 2022)

4-18, mean 8.6 (Goldberg and Beaman 2004, Aguirre and Gatica 2010, Jimenez‐Arcos et al. 2017, mean also cited in Dominguez-Guerrero et al. 2022), Foster et al. 2019 (2 females laid clutchers of 21 and 19 and 19 and 18 eggs in consecutive years), 4-18 but more than 20 in captivity (Heimes 2022)

Keeping one
2 ft 4 in × 2 ft 4 in × 17 in(70 × 70 × 44 cm)
Minimum length × width × height, for one animal. Bigger is always better.
The standard sizes ground-dwelling species at 4 × 4 × 2.5 times snout-vent length.
Lives on rock, so stable hard surfaces and basking ledges suit it.
Mindestanforderungen an die Haltung von Reptilien (Sachverständigengutachten), German Federal Ministry for Nutrition, Agriculture and Forestry, Animal Welfare Division, 10 January 1997. The standard states these floor areas are recommendations rather than binding limits.
From this animal’s own snout-vent length of 7 in (175 mm), at 4 × 4 × 2.5 times it, following the German federal welfare standard — how this is worked out.
In a laboratory thermal gradient this species settled at 88–95 °F (31.3–35.2 °C).
Preferred body temperature, recorded in a laboratory gradient where the animal could choose freely. A measurement of the animal, not a setting for a thermostat.
Feeding
A prey item should be no wider than the space between the animal's eyes.
Widely used across reptile husbandry references. The stated reason is that the gap approximates the width of the throat, so wider prey is associated with impaction. This is established practice, not a measurement.
16kJ per day
Worked out for an animal of 141 g, the heaviest recorded for Baja California Rock Lizard — so it is the top of the range, not a figure for a particular animal. Weigh yours and the number will be lower.
An upper estimate, not a feeding target, and not veterinary advice. The equation covers only what an animal burns staying alive, so a growing, gravid or recovering animal needs more — and it was measured on wild animals, which move far more than one in an enclosure. Body condition and a vet who knows the species are what a feeding decision should rest on. Where this comes from.
